When making a payment using RMB Bank Transfer (人民币银行转账), you are required to provide the actual payer’s Mainland Chinese National Identity card details. This is required by local foreign exchange regulations and is used for verification.
Payer Requirements for RMB Bank Transfers
This payment method is only available to Mainland Chinese citizens using a valid Mainland Chinese National Identity card.
- If the payer uses a passport or any other type of identification, verification will fail automatically.
- In this case, you will need to cancel your current payment request and choose a different payment method, such as UnionPay online, Visa, Mastercard, or International Bank Transfer.
What Chinese National Identity card details are required?
When creating your payment request, please enter the details of the actual bank account holder making the payment:
- Payer’s Name: Enter the name exactly as shown on the Chinese National Identity card, using Chinese characters (do not use Pinyin or English).
- Identity Card Number: Enter the standard 18-digit Mainland Chinese National Identity card number.
- Match the Bank Account: The information must match the bank account holder. For example, if a parent or relative is paying on your behalf, you should enter their Chinese National Identity card details, not the student’s.
Important: If the Chinese National Identity card details do not match the actual bank account holder, the verification will fail and may delay or interrupt your RMB Bank Transfer.
What should I do if my Payer details do not match?
If there is a mismatch, you will receive a notification email. You can update your information by following these steps:
- Click the payment tracking link provided in your mismatch notification email.
- Log in to your Flywire account.
- Click My Account (in the top right corner), go to My Payments, and select this specific payment request.
- Click View Payment, then locate and click the Edit Payment Details button.
- Update the information: Correct the Payer’s Name (using Chinese characters) or the Identity Card Number so it perfectly matches the actual bank account holder who transferred the funds.
- Click Save to submit your changes.
Guest users: If you checked out as a guest, please click “Sign Up” to create an account first. Once logged in, click "Add Payment" on your dashboard to link this specific request to your profile.
How long does Chinese National Identity card verification take?
Once you update the payer's information, your payment request will automatically be resubmitted for verification. This new review process typically takes 24–48 hours (excluding weekends and public holidays), and you will be notified of the result via email.
To avoid payment delays, please update your information as soon as you receive the notification. If the final verification fails or is not corrected in time, your payment request may be canceled and the funds will be returned.
